clangd: Implement switch source/header extension (#14646)
Release Notes: - Added switch source/header action for clangd language server (fixes [#12801](https://github.com/zed-industries/zed/issues/12801)). Note: I'm new to both rust and this codebase. I started my implementation by copying how rust analyzer's "expand macro" LSP extension is implemented. I don't yet understand some of the code I copied (mostly the way to get the `server_to_query` in `clangd_ext.rs` and the whole proto implementation). --------- Co-authored-by: Kirill Bulatov <kirill@zed.dev>
